I. D. Hill - Late 19th Century Oil The Hay Harvest
Description
A beautiful Victorian oil landscape depicting late Summer afternoon in a hay field. A group of figures work at harvesting the hay into stooks. A woman rests in the shade to the right with a dog and a man and woman pause from their work to exchange conversation. The artist has wonderfully captured the hazy golden glow of the romanticised view of countryside workers, prevalent during the late Victorian era.
The artist has signed to the lower right corner and the painting has been presented in its original handsome, gilt, gesso frame with botanical strap work and gilt slip.
On board.Condition
The condition is typical for a picture of this age including some discolouration and craquelure. There is slight outward bowing to the board but this is not noticeable when view front on. The frame has had several areas of restoration but is in generally fine condition.
